Emotional Support in Childbirth Lowers Maternal Risks
Research indicates that emotional support during childbirth significantly reduces maternal stress and lowers the risk of complications. Disparities in pregnancy-related mortality rates among different racial groups in the United States are significant, and a lack of emotional support is a key contributing factor. Support from fathers, family members, and professionals can help ensure maternal and infant safety. Providing adequate emotional support is crucial for improving birth outcomes and addressing racial disparities in maternal health.

Study Links Neonicotinoids to Butterfly Population Decline
Recent research links neonicotinoid pesticides to the decline in butterfly populations and diversity in the Midwestern United States. The study highlights the impact of pesticides on butterfly nervous systems, advocating for reduced pesticide use, habitat protection, and enhanced data monitoring to safeguard butterflies and maintain ecological balance. The findings underscore the urgent need for sustainable agricultural practices to mitigate the negative effects of pesticides on these vital pollinators and preserve biodiversity.

Parasites Impede Moose Recovery in Adirondacks
Moose populations in the Adirondacks are recovering slowly, primarily due to parasite infections. White-tailed deer act as intermediate hosts, spreading parasites that threaten moose survival. Key strategies for promoting moose population recovery include controlling white-tailed deer populations, improving habitat, and strengthening disease monitoring efforts. These measures are crucial to mitigate the impact of parasites and support the long-term health and growth of the Adirondack moose population.
